Nothing But The Best celebrates Expressions Gallery’s Fifth Anniversary with a retrospective show presenting past and current work by featured artists from each of the previous shows. Also part of this show is a memorial presentation of the artwork of William Hung, the famous Chinese artist who recently died who exhibited at Expressions Gallery. Some of Hung's work is presented as well as some artwork by his daughter Sandra Lo who was strongly influenced and encouraged by her father.
